Action item: the Vellum 3.1 planner regression shipped because cost-model constants weren't re-baselined after the stats refactor. Release manager must block future planner releases until benchmark gate passes and constants are reviewed. Rollback to 3.0 values is the interim mitigation; patch 3.1.1 carries them. The reviewed constants to ship are:

tuning constants:
TIERS = {
    "sorion": 670,
    "istax": 547,
}

## Account Recovery — Schemavault Registry

Heads up, reviewer: if the Schemavault admin account gets locked, event schema publishes will queue up fast and producers at Trelling Systems start failing validation. Don't panic. Restart the registry pod, then trigger the recovery flow from the ops console. It'll prompt for the recovery passphrase before re-enabling writes. Check the diff carefully before approving. The passphrase for the Schemavault admin account is below.

unlock words, yawig-kagef: gordor-holvan-ulaael-pramir-ulaiel-tamdor

[ ] Step 9 — Archive the Plumevale loyalty-ledger root key material. After both officers sign the ceremony record, place the printed key shares in tamper-evident bags and log bag numbers in the Hollis register. Future rotations must reference this entry. The encrypted digital backup lives in cold storage at the Tarnmere facility; it is intentionally offline. Any maintainer restoring from that backup must decrypt it using the recovery passphrase recorded immediately below.

recovery phrase for yajof-tafog: gilath-druok-kasax-tamvan-aldath-prair-gorir-istwyn-normir-novok